"Photogravure" by Henry R. Blaney is a comprehensive exploration of the photogravure process, a technique that revolutionized printmaking and photography. Blaney delves into the history and development of photogravure, detailing its significance in the art world and its impact on the reproduction of images. The book serves as both a technical guide and a historical account, making it an essential read for artists, photographers, and printmakers interested in the intricate relationship between photography and print media. Blaney's expertise shines through in his detailed explanations and insights. *** In addition to its technical aspects, "Photogravure" also highlights the aesthetic qualities of the medium. Blaney discusses various artists and their contributions to photogravure, showcasing how this technique has been used to create stunning visual works. The book features numerous illustrations that exemplify the beauty and depth achievable through photogravure, inspiring readers to appreciate the artistry involved. Overall, Blaney's work is a valuable resource for anyone looking to understand the nuances of photogravure and its place in the broader context of art and photography.
